| 0:00.0 | Well, howdy there, Internet people, it's Bell again. |
| 0:05.6 | So today, we're going to talk about Democrats winning the special election for Hortman's Minnesota seat. |
| 0:13.5 | On Tuesday, Minnesota voters chose a successor for the widely beloved state representative, Melissa Hortman. Democrat XP Lee defeated Republican |
| 0:24.7 | Ruth Bittner. It looks like Lee won by more than 20 percentage points, which wasn't really a |
| 0:31.1 | surprise in the solidly blue district. Lee was born in Thailand after his family reportedly fled Laos during the Vietnam War. |
| 0:40.3 | Lee, who is a former Brooklyn Park City Council member, will fill the remainder of Hortman's term. |
| 0:47.8 | While the results weren't surprising, they were long awaited and added a small amount of closure |
| 0:53.7 | to two separate news items. |
| 0:56.8 | Lee's predecessor, Melissa Hortman, was the caucus leader, and the former speaker when she and her |
| 1:03.0 | husband, Mark, were killed in their home back in June in an act of political violence. Her memory |
| 1:09.6 | hung over the election in every possible way. |
| 1:13.6 | In his victory speech, Lee promised to work hard to honor her legacy and commented how, quote, |
| 1:20.5 | We did our best to make her proud, knocking on doors daily, making phone calls, and texting every neighbor we could. |
| 1:29.4 | This is understandably going to be the focus of the national news coverage of the election, |
| 1:35.1 | but there was also a pretty big political question being resolved in the state. |
| 1:40.8 | The 2024 election saw the Minnesota State House get evenly split between Republicans and Democrats. |
| 1:48.4 | There was a power-sharing agreement in place that was brokered by former House Speaker Hortman. |
| 1:55.0 | Lee's win restores the 67-to-67 balance and maintains the power-sharing agreement. That agreement, which |
| 2:04.3 | evenly splits a lot of committees, is going to be incredibly important to the Democratic Party |
| 2:10.1 | almost immediately. Democratic Governor Tim Walz, who recently announced that he would run for |
| 2:16.8 | a third term, said he was going |
